Sorry I've read the whole voima thread and couldn't find an answer.
Is it possible to convert from rim magnet to rotor magnet by buying the kit and fitting it, or is a visit to a Bosch dealer required?

I gather the rotor magnet is preferable if you wish to go a little faster..

Pole answered my query today. A visit to the dealers is required.
The parts needed to convert are off the shelf Bosch.
 
Can you share the info? There are probably others who are curious.
Unverified but I think it's these bits needed. Cables come in different lengths so would have to be measured.
Plus a suitable rotor magnet of course.
